CareSolace - Calming the Chaos of Mental Health Care

South Western School District is now partnered with Care Solace. Care Solace connects students, families, and staff to available mental health and substance use providers for free and regardless of insurance. If you would like to be referred to Care Solace, feel free to reach out to building or district administration. You may also initiate the process anonymously at caresolace.com/swsd.

School Board Meetings

The South Western School District will hold regular School Board Meetings per the established schedule and the public is welcome to attend. Masking is optional for any face-to-face meetings.

Anyone wishing to address the Board should email their request ten (10) days in advance to: [email protected] (per Policy 903). Please indicate in the email your name, organization, and the topic you would like to present, so that you can be acknowledged. Any comments submitted through this email will be forwarded to the Board for review.

Please note: Comments from the public will always be welcomed at the end of every Board meeting.
